Top questions to ask before hiring a metal worker & welder

A professional will assist you with scope and estimates, but having a clear idea of what you want to accomplish will help communication.

Do you want professionals to do everything, or do you have the time and skill to do some of the work?

Many projects such as have a DIY component, such as painting or cleanup.

First and foremost, protect yourself and make sure the contractor and any sub-contractors are licensed, bonded and insured.

How does invoicing/payment work for most Metal Worker & Welder projects in Nevada City?

Every project differs, but you should ask any metal worker & welder for an estimate, before they do any work. In fact, ask for their general payment terms before any metal worker services work is done.

If the job is large and going to take longer than a day, it's common practice for metal workers & welders to request a down payment. Usually, this will be around 25% so they can commence work on your metal worker & welder project.

If it's a quick job, you'll likely be given an invoice/bill when the job is complete. Then it's up to you and the metal worker & welder to determine if you pay immediately or can send payment at a later date.
